The upcoming clash between Marítimo and Benfica B promises to be one of the most intriguing fixtures of the 14th round in Liga Portugal 2. Scheduled for Sunday afternoon, this encounter at the Estádio dos Barreiros brings together two sides in contrasting positions but both in good spirits after recent victories. The hosts are enjoying a remarkable run that has propelled them to the top of the table, while the visitors are looking to build on their recent improvement and climb further away from the lower half of the standings.
Marítimo enter this match as league leaders, sitting first in Liga Portugal 2 with 29 points, level with Sporting B. Their recent form has been nothing short of outstanding, boasting five consecutive wins and a defensive record that has made them one of the toughest teams to beat. In their last two outings, they secured back-to-back 2-0 victories against Torreense and Portimonense, underlining their consistency and attacking efficiency.
Across their last five matches, Marítimo have recorded five wins, no draws, and no defeats, averaging 2.0 goals scored and just 0.2 conceded per game. Over the course of the season, their record stands at 9 wins, 2 draws, and 3 losses, with an average of 1.4 goals scored and 0.6 conceded per match. These numbers highlight a team that combines solid defense with clinical finishing, especially at home, where they have been nearly unstoppable. Their head-to-head record against Benfica B also favors them, with three wins and one draw in their last four meetings, scoring an average of 1.8 goals per game while conceding only 0.8.
Confidence is high among the islanders, who have turned the Estádio dos Barreiros into a fortress. Their ability to control matches and maintain composure even under pressure has been key to their success. With momentum on their side, Marítimo will aim to extend their winning streak and consolidate their position at the top of the table.
Benfica B travel to Madeira in decent form, having picked up a 2-0 home win over Oliveirense in their most recent outing. That result lifted them to 14 points and 12th place in the standings, providing a much-needed boost after a mixed start to the campaign. In the previous round, they drew 2-2 away at Leiria, showing resilience and attacking intent. Overall, their last five matches have produced two wins, one draw, and two defeats, with an average of 2.0 goals scored and 1.8 conceded per game.
Throughout the season, Benfica B’s record stands at 3 wins, 5 draws, and 5 losses, averaging 1.5 goals scored and 1.6 conceded per match. Their attacking approach often leads to open games, as reflected by the fact that Over 1.5 goals have been scored in each of their last 19 league matches. Moreover, there has been at least one goal in the second half in their last 10 fixtures, confirming their tendency to stay competitive until the final whistle.
Although their away record is modest, with only six points collected on the road, Benfica B have shown they can challenge strong opponents. Narrow defeats against teams like Feirense and Farense demonstrate that they are capable of putting up a fight even in difficult environments. Their young squad continues to develop, and this trip to face the league leaders will serve as a valuable test of their progress.
This fixture brings together two sides with contrasting objectives but similar attacking mindsets. Marítimo will look to maintain their dominance at home, relying on their solid defense and efficient attack, while Benfica B will aim to disrupt their rhythm with quick transitions and youthful energy. The hosts’ recent form and home advantage make them favorites, but the visitors’ ability to score in almost every match suggests that this could be a lively contest.
Historically, Marítimo have had the upper hand in this matchup, and their current momentum supports the expectation of another positive result. However, Benfica B’s offensive consistency means that both teams could find the net, especially given the high frequency of matches involving over 1.5 goals for the visitors. Fans can anticipate an entertaining game with chances at both ends, where Marítimo’s experience and composure might ultimately make the difference.
